What Are Prefabricated Structures?

Prefabricated structures are buildings or components manufactured in a factory setting and assembled at the construction site. Unlike traditional construction, where materials are processed on-site, prefabrication ensures controlled production, reduced waste, and higher quality.

These structures include components such as steel frames, wall panels, roof systems, and modular units that are pre-designed and fabricated before installation. Because of their efficiency and performance, Pre fabricated buildings are widely used across industrial, commercial, and infrastructure projects.

Types of Prefabricated Structures

Prefabricated construction offers various types of structures based on design, material, and application.

1. Steel Prefabricated Structures

A steel prefabricated building is one of the most commonly used types due to its strength and flexibility. These structures are ideal for large-scale industrial applications such as warehouses and manufacturing units.

2. Modular Prefabricated Buildings

Modular structures are built in sections or modules that are transported and assembled on-site. These are commonly used for offices, site buildings, and temporary infrastructure.

3. Pre Engineered Buildings (PEB)

Pre-engineered buildings are advanced steel structures designed using optimized engineering techniques. Pre engineered buildings India are widely used for industrial and commercial construction due to their speed and cost efficiency.

4. Panel Built Structures

These buildings use pre-made wall and roof panels that are assembled on-site. They are commonly used for cold storage, clean rooms, and specialized industrial facilities.

Industrial Benefits of Prefabricated Structures

The growing adoption of Prefabricated Structures is driven by several key advantages that make them superior to traditional construction methods.

1. Faster Construction Timelines

Prefabrication allows simultaneous site preparation and component manufacturing, reducing overall project duration significantly. This enables businesses to start operations earlier and improve return on investment.

2. Cost Efficiency

Optimized material usage, reduced labor requirements, and minimal on-site waste contribute to lower construction costs. This makes prefabrication a financially viable solution for large industrial projects.

3. High Structural Strength and Durability

Prefabricated steel structures are designed using advanced engineering techniques and high-quality materials, ensuring long-term durability and resistance to environmental conditions.

4. Design Flexibility

Prefabricated buildings can be customized to meet specific project requirements. Features such as clear spans, mezzanine floors, and expansion capabilities allow businesses to scale operations easily.

5. Sustainable Construction

Prefabrication reduces material wastage and supports energy-efficient construction practices. Steel structures are recyclable, making them an environmentally friendly choice.
